Safety Design Trends in the Petroleum Industry

The petroleum industry is continually evolving, and with it, the approach to safety design. Today’s trends go beyond compliance, focusing on human-centered principles and digital innovation to create safer, more efficient work environments. The Evolution of Safety Design in High-Risk Environments

Safety design has moved from simple warning signs to comprehensive visual systems. The goal is to communicate risk and procedure with instant clarity, reducing cognitive load on workers in high-pressure situations.

Trend 1: Interactive and Digital Safety Solutions

Digital dashboards, mobile apps, and augmented reality are transforming safety training and information delivery. These tools provide real-time data and interactive guides, making safety information more accessible and engaging than static manuals.

Trend 2: Human-Centered Design Principles

Modern safety design focuses on the end-user. By understanding worker behaviors and challenges, designers can create intuitive visual cues and workflows that align with natural human responses, significantly reducing the likelihood of error.

Trend 3: Data Visualization for Risk Management

Complex risk data is being transformed into clear, concise infographics and dashboards. This allows managers and teams to quickly assess operational risks and make informed decisions, enhancing overall safety performance.
